How Montgomery AL Probate Office Hours of Operation and Services Actually Works

The probate office in Montgomery handles legal processes related to estates, wills, and court-supervised administration. Their official hours define when the public can visit or contact the office for in-person assistance. Typically, these hours align with standard regional business days, though exact times can vary based on staff availability and public demand. For someone walking through a difficult situation, knowing these hours provides a reliable anchor point in an otherwise uncertain timeline. The services offered include filing documents, obtaining necessary forms, and receiving guidance on procedural next steps in a respectful, confidential setting.

Common Questions People Have About Montgomery AL Probate Office Hours of Operation and Services

Many people wonder what documents they should bring when visiting the office for the first time. Typical items include identification, relevant legal papers, and any correspondence previously received regarding the matter at hand. Arriving prepared can streamline the interaction and demonstrate respect for the time of both the visitor and the staff. Another frequent question revolves around whether certain steps can be completed remotely or via phone, which highlights the growing adaptation of services to modern needs.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One widespread assumption is that probate is only necessary for wealthy estates, which is simply not accurate. In reality, these processes apply to a wide range of situations involving property, assets, and personal belongings. Another misconception is that every step must be handled entirely in person, whereas some initial inquiries or document requests can occur through digital or mail channels. Clarifying these points helps set appropriate expectations and reduces unnecessary stress. People often underestimate how much guidance is available when they reach out.
